  • Patent number: 6155728
    Abstract: A type printer in which deterioration of a platen is prevented by distributing positions of impacts on the platen by a printing head over the whole region of peripheral surface of a cylindrical platen. The drive shafts of a paper feed roller, platen, and tractor are operatively connected to each other by a gear train, and driven by a motor. The gear ratio of gears in the gear train is selected so that the peripheral velocities of the paper feed roller, platen, and tractor agree with each other. The platen rotates in synchronism with the feed velocity of paper fed by the paper feed roller and the tractor, by which the positions of impacts, which are effected by the printing head, are distributed over the whole region on the peripheral surface of the platen.

  • Patent number: 6126347
    Abstract: First and second sheet guides (21, 31) are arranged individually in front and at the back of a print head (6) in a sheet feeding direction. Each of these sheet guides (21, 31) has an arcuate end edge opposite to the print head (6), the width-direction central portion of the end edge being located at the longest distance from the print head so that the space between the end edge and the print head gradually increases with lateral distance from the width-direction central portion of the end edge. In consequence, the leading end portion of a sheet that is printed by means of the print head (6), especially its opposite ends, can be prevented from abutting against the sheet guides (21, 31) and causing jamming due to deformation of the sheet or the like as the leading end portion of the sheet passes through a gap between a conveyor plate (9) and the sheet guides (21, 31).

  • Patent number: 5894717
    Abstract: A mulching mower is provided which is capable of cutting grasses finely without leaving uncut grasses and which is capable of discharging the cut grass clippings onto the cut grass path so as to be evenly dispersed. A pair of cutter blades are arranged to the right and to the left of the mulching mower in a cutter housing which opens downwardly. A guitar-shaped or figure 8 shaped enclosure wall hangs down from an under surface of an upper wall of the cutter housing to completely surround the periphery of the right and left cutter blades along tip end rotation loci of the blades at a slight distance therefrom. The enclosure wall is formed by side wall portions ar right and left outsides of the cutter housing and front and rear enclosure wall portions hang down from the under surface. The cutter blades rotate in opposite directions from each other so that tip ends of the cutter blades move from front to rear at right and left outsides, respectively, of the mulching mower.

  • Patent number: 4403954
    Abstract: An apparatus for heat-treating pipes comprising a furnace chamber for accommodating a plurality of pipes as arranged in parallel, a chain conveyor disposed in the furnace chamber for transporting the pipes in a direction at right angles to the axes of the pipes, and a plurality of stopper means for stopping the pipes intermittently at suitably spaced-apart positions in the path of transport by the chain conveyor and causing each of the pipes to rotate about its own axis in cooperation with the chain conveyor. Since the pipe is intermittently stopped and rotated about its own axis during heat treatment, the pipe is free of thermal deformation to an elliptical shape. Pipes can be heat-treated in succession in a small space, therefore with a very high efficiency. The motion of the chain conveyor is utilized for rotating the pipe without necessitating any additional device for the rotation.

  • Patent number: 4183655
    Abstract: An image transfer unit provided with cleaning means for use in an electrophotographic copying machine comprising an electrically conductive transfer roller disposed in abutting relationship with a photosensitive member, an electrically conductive, rotatable cleaning means disposed in abutting relationship with the transfer roller, and electrical bias means connected with the cleaning means and having a switchable polarity. During a transfer step, a bias voltage of opposite polarity to that of the toner is applied to the transfer roller through the cleaning means. At this time, toner attaching to the transfer roller is electrostatically transferred onto the cleaning means. During a cleaning step, a bias voltage of the same polarity as the toner is applied to the cleaning means, whereby the toner attaching thereto is transferred back to the photosensitive member through the transfer roller. The toner which is transferred back to the photosensitive member is removed by separate cleaning means.
